Hello Piyush, Sorry I took so long. I tested the installation on my own Windows machine, and I had the exact same error (Could not open requirements file: [Errno 2] No such file or directory: 'c:\\Projects\\env\\Lib\\site-packages\\arches\\install\\requirements.txt').
